Yin consists of passive long-held poses (3 – 5 minutes) that are meant to affect the joints and connective tissues of the body. It is a quiet and slow practice that is very complimentary to the more muscular yang type yoga. This class incorporates classical Yin with some restorative style support for practitioners when necessary. Good for all levels of students.

Restorative Yoga is also known as the yoga of non-doing. This class will offer practitioners the opportunity to slow down and enjoy a prolonged yoga practice that utilizes blankets, pillows and other props to help relieve stress and restore balance and harmony to the body and mind. Good for all levels of students.
